Journey Duration: How Long is the Train Ride? (Birmingham to Manchester)
The journey duration between Birmingham and Manchester by train can vary depending on several factors, including the specific route, the number of stops, and the type of train service. Generally, you can expect the train journey to take anywhere from 1 hour 30 minutes to 2 hours. Direct trains, typically operated by Avanti West Coast, offer the fastest travel times, as they don't require any changes along the way. These trains usually take around 1 hour 30 minutes to 1 hour 45 minutes. However, some routes may involve a change at a station such as Crewe, Stoke-on-Trent, or Stafford. If your journey includes a change, the total travel time will naturally be longer, potentially closer to the 2-hour mark or slightly beyond. Popular Train Operators: Avanti West Coast, Northern, and More
Several train operators provide services between Birmingham and Manchester, each offering different benefits and route options. The main operators include Avanti West Coast, Northern, and Transport for Wales. Avanti West Coast is known for its fast, direct services that typically run from Birmingham New Street to Manchester Piccadilly. These trains often offer comfortable seating, onboard Wi-Fi, and refreshment services. Northern operates more regional services, which may involve more stops and potentially a change along the way. Their trains connect various towns and cities across the North of England, including Birmingham and Manchester. Transport for Wales also offers services on this route, often connecting Birmingham with destinations in Wales and Northwest England. Ticket Options and Fares: Getting the Best Deal for Birmingham to Manchester Train Tickets
Navigating the world of train tickets and fares can be confusing, but with a little knowledge, you can secure the best deal for your Birmingham to Manchester train journey. Several factors influence the price of train tickets, including the time of day, the day of the week, how far in advance you book, and the type of ticket you choose. Advance tickets are usually the cheapest option. These tickets are available for purchase weeks or even months before your travel date and offer significant discounts compared to buying tickets on the day of travel. However, advance tickets often come with restrictions, such as being non-refundable or only valid on a specific train. Off-peak tickets are another way to save money. These tickets are valid for travel during less busy times of the day, typically outside of morning and evening rush hours. Off-peak times vary depending on the train operator, so it is advisable to check the specific terms and conditions before booking. Anytime tickets offer the most flexibility. These tickets are valid for travel on any train on your chosen route, regardless of the time of day. However, they are also the most expensive option. If you are unsure about your travel plans or need the flexibility to change your journey, an anytime ticket may be the best choice. Railcards can provide significant discounts on train travel. If you are eligible for a railcard, such as the 16-25 Railcard, Senior Railcard, or Family & Friends Railcard, you can save up to one-third on your train tickets. Consider purchasing a railcard if you travel by train frequently, as the savings can quickly add up. Websites such as Trainline and National Rail Enquiries allow you to compare ticket prices from different train operators. These sites can also help you find the cheapest fares and identify any available discounts. Booking directly with the train operator can sometimes offer advantages, such as lower booking fees or access to exclusive deals. If you have a preferred train operator, it is worth checking their website to see if they have any special offers available. When booking your train tickets, be sure to enter your travel dates and times accurately to ensure you are seeing the correct fares. You should also specify the number of passengers and whether any of them are eligible for discounts, such as children or seniors. Consider a split ticketing strategy to save money on your train travel. Split ticketing involves booking separate tickets for different sections of your journey, rather than buying a single ticket for the entire route. This can sometimes be cheaper, especially for long-distance journeys. You can use websites like SplitSave to identify potential split ticketing opportunities. Birmingham and Manchester Stations: Navigating Your Departure and Arrival
Familiarizing yourself with the departure and arrival stations in Birmingham and Manchester can make your train journey smoother and more enjoyable. In Birmingham, the main station serving trains to Manchester is Birmingham New Street. This is the busiest station in the UK outside of London, so it is important to allow plenty of time to navigate through the station, especially during peak hours. Birmingham New Street has multiple platforms, shops, restaurants, and ticket offices. Be sure to check the departure boards upon arrival to confirm your train's platform number. The station is well-connected to local transportation, including buses, trams (via the West Midlands Metro), and taxis. You can easily reach other parts of Birmingham from New Street Station. In Manchester, the primary arrival station for trains from Birmingham is Manchester Piccadilly. This is also a large and busy station, serving as a major transportation hub for the North West of England. Manchester Piccadilly has several platforms, shops, cafes, and waiting areas. As with Birmingham New Street, it is advisable to check the arrival boards to confirm your train's platform number. Manchester Piccadilly is well-connected to the city's public transportation network. The station has an underground Metrolink tram stop, providing easy access to destinations throughout Greater Manchester. There are also numerous bus routes and taxi ranks located outside the station. Both Birmingham New Street and Manchester Piccadilly offer accessible facilities for passengers with disabilities, including ramps, lifts, accessible toilets, and assistance services. If you require assistance, it is best to book it in advance through the train operator or station staff. Plan your route from your home or hotel to Birmingham New Street in advance. Use a journey planning app or website to identify the best transportation options and allow ample time for travel. Similarly, plan your route from Manchester Piccadilly to your final destination in Manchester. Consider using public transportation, taxis, or ride-sharing services. Both stations have luggage storage facilities where you can store your bags for a fee. This can be useful if you have some time to explore the city before or after your train journey.
